You are inventorying **agents** for the project. Agents are first-class deployable artifacts; like Flows and Apex, they live in source control under `force-app/main/default/botDefinitions/` and are also visible in the org's Agent Registry. This skill reconciles the two.

The conventional path for AgentDefinition metadata in DX is `<packageDir>/main/default/botDefinitions/<AgentName>/`. If a project uses a non-standard layout, set `paths.agentDefinitions` in `sf-project.json` and this skill reads from there.

For each `<AgentName>/` subdirectory, parse:
- `<AgentName>.botDefinition-meta.xml` — top-level definition
- `<AgentName>.botVersion-meta.xml` — version metadata, active flag
- `topics/*.topic-meta.xml` — topic boundaries (one .topic file per topic)
- `actions/*.action-meta.xml` — bound actions (Apex, Flow, prompt template, MCP tool)
- `subAgents/*.subAgent-meta.xml` — sub-agent declarations

### 3. Reconcile

For each agent, classify:
| State | Meaning |
|-------|---------|
| ✅ in source AND active in org | tracked |
| ⚠️ in source AND inactive in org | source-only / draft |
| ⚠️ active in org NOT in source | untracked (won't deploy elsewhere; missing from CI/CD) |
| ⚠️ in source but org has newer version | drift — run `/argo:org-diff` to inspect |

## Rules

- **Don't read agent prompts in detail.** Topic & action enumeration is enough; full prompt diffing belongs in `/argo:org-diff` or a code review
- **Honor managed-package agents.** Agents owned by an installed package are reported in a separate "From Managed Packages" section, not as findings
- **Surface MCP tool bindings.** When an agent binds an MCP tool as an action, surface the tool definition file path so reviewers can audit both sides
- **Don't auto-resolve drift.** Report; the user picks retrieve vs. deploy
